云服务器是什么原理制作的,揭秘云服务器原理,从虚拟化到智能运维,全方位解析云服务架构
- 综合资讯
- 2024-12-04 08:32:25
- 2

云服务器通过虚拟化技术将物理服务器资源虚拟化为多个独立虚拟机,实现资源共享和按需分配。从虚拟化到智能运维,云服务架构包括资源管理、自动化部署、性能优化等环节,确保高效稳...
云服务器通过虚拟化技术将物理服务器资源虚拟化为多个独立虚拟机,实现资源共享和按需分配。从虚拟化到智能运维,云服务架构包括资源管理、自动化部署、性能优化等环节,确保高效稳定运行。本文全方位解析云服务器原理,揭秘其架构及运维之道。
随着互联网技术的飞速发展,云计算已成为当今信息技术领域的一大热点,云服务器作为云计算的核心组成部分,为企业提供了强大的计算能力和灵活的资源配置,本文将深入解析云服务器的原理,从虚拟化技术到智能运维,带您全方位了解云服务架构。
云服务器概述
1、定义
云服务器(Cloud Server)是指运行在云计算平台上的虚拟服务器,用户可以通过互联网访问云服务器,获取所需的计算资源和服务,云服务器具有虚拟化、弹性伸缩、按需付费等特点。
2、优势
(1)高可用性:云服务器通过分布式存储和计算,确保系统稳定运行,降低故障风险。
(2)弹性伸缩:根据业务需求,自动调整计算资源,实现高效利用。
(3)低成本:用户只需支付实际使用的资源费用,降低企业IT成本。
(4)便捷管理:云服务器提供统一的运维管理平台,简化运维工作。
云服务器原理
1、虚拟化技术
虚拟化是云服务器实现的核心技术,通过虚拟化技术,将物理服务器划分为多个虚拟机(VM),每个虚拟机拥有独立的操作系统和资源,虚拟化技术主要包括以下几种:
(1)硬件虚拟化:通过虚拟化硬件资源,实现多个操作系统在物理服务器上并行运行。
(2)操作系统虚拟化:在操作系统层面实现虚拟化,提高资源利用率。
(3)应用虚拟化:将应用程序与操作系统分离,实现跨平台运行。
2、分布式存储
分布式存储是云服务器提供海量数据存储的基础,通过将数据分散存储在多个物理设备上,提高数据可靠性和访问速度,分布式存储技术主要包括:
(1)分布式文件系统:如HDFS、Ceph等,实现海量数据的高效存储和访问。
(2)分布式数据库:如HBase、Cassandra等,满足大规模数据存储和查询需求。
3、弹性伸缩
弹性伸缩是云服务器应对业务波动的关键,通过自动调整计算资源,实现高效利用,弹性伸缩技术主要包括:
(1)自动扩展:根据业务需求,自动增加或减少虚拟机数量。
(2)手动扩展:用户根据需求手动调整虚拟机数量。
4、智能运维
智能运维是云服务器提高运维效率的重要手段,通过自动化、智能化的运维手段,降低运维成本,智能运维技术主要包括:
(1)自动化运维:通过脚本、工具实现自动化部署、监控、备份等任务。
(2)智能监控:利用大数据、人工智能等技术,实现实时监控和故障预警。
云服务架构
1、IaaS层
IaaS(Infrastructure as a Service)层提供基础设施服务,包括计算、存储、网络等资源,IaaS层主要包括以下组件:
(1)虚拟化平台:如VMware、Xen等,实现物理服务器到虚拟机的转换。
(2)分布式存储系统:如HDFS、Ceph等,提供海量数据存储。
(3)网络设备:如交换机、路由器等,实现网络连接。
2、paas层
PaaS(Platform as a Service)层提供平台服务,包括操作系统、数据库、中间件等,PaaS层主要包括以下组件:
(1)操作系统:如Linux、Windows等,为应用程序提供运行环境。
(2)数据库:如MySQL、Oracle等,提供数据存储和查询。
(3)中间件:如Apache、Tomcat等,实现应用程序之间的通信。
3、SaaS层
SaaS(Software as a Service)层提供软件服务,包括企业应用、办公软件等,SaaS层主要包括以下组件:
(1)企业应用:如ERP、CRM等,满足企业业务需求。
(2)办公软件:如Office、WPS等,提供办公协作功能。
云服务器作为云计算的核心组成部分,具有诸多优势,通过虚拟化、分布式存储、弹性伸缩和智能运维等技术,云服务器为用户提供高效、稳定、安全的计算资源和服务,随着云计算技术的不断发展,云服务器将在未来发挥越来越重要的作用。
本文链接:https://www.zhitaoyun.cn/1307993.html
发表评论